Payday loans and cash advances are short-term loans due on your next payday. They carry significant risk: APRs often reach 300–400% and short terms can create debt cycles, so consider lower-cost options first. Credit unions are member-owned and typically offer lower rates, fewer fees, and more flexible criteria than online lenders or payday lenders, including payday alternative loans (PALs) capped at 28% APR. Membership often just requires living or working in Salt Lake City or Utah.

The typical Salt Lake City household earns about $74,925 a year — roughly $6,244 a month before taxes. With median rent near $1,343, housing alone takes about 22% of a median household's monthly income. When most of a paycheck is already committed, an unexpected $500–$2,500 expense can be hard to absorb from savings — which is why many Salt Lake City residents look at short-term financing to bridge the gap.
| If you borrow | Share of a median Salt Lake City monthly income |
|---|---|
| $500 | ≈ 8% of one month's household income |
| $1,000 | ≈ 16% of one month's household income |
| $2,500 | ≈ 40% of one month's household income |
| $5,000 | ≈ 80% of one month's household income |
Figures use Salt Lake City's median household income for illustration only; your own budget, income, and lender terms determine what you can afford. Borrow only what you can comfortably repay.
